Two more outlets will follow in Jurong East, one by December and another next January.

Mr Yasuda says Don Don Donki appeals to employees - even attracting those from other retail businesses - because they are treated as managers instead of mere workers, and are given autonomy.STIFF labour conditions and pricey property rents may be the bane of retailers in Singapore, but Don Don Donki is not letting such troubles get in the way of its rapid expansion.

Being able to draw crowds to quieter parts of malls, landlords are happy to offer lower rents for Donki to set up shop."We can't say how cheap our rents are, but we receive quite reasonable price offers," Mr Yasuda told The Business Times in an interview at his office at Marina Bay Financial Centre.The first Donki store in Singapore was opened at Orchard Central's basement after Far East Organisation approached them with a good rental price.

Mr Yasuda, an avid diver, said the company appeals to employees - even attracting those from other retail businesses - because they are treated as managers instead of mere workers, and are given autonomy. This comes as the retailer looks to bring its fascinating range of wares to the suburbs, where it sees huge opportunity. It means Donki may also set up shop at MRT stations in residential areas, he said.

"Mega Donki stores sell more than just Japanese goods whereas we're specialising in Japanese food and products in Singapore," Mr Yasuda explained."If we open that in Singapore, we will be competing with local retailers and won't be welcome." He wants to see 200 stores overseas in the next five years, up from 42 stores now. In comparison, Pan Pacific operates 656 stores in Japan as of end-January.
